Prokaryotes
Primitive single-celled organisms whose genetic material is dispersed in the central region of the cytoplasm without a nuclear membrane, thereby lacking a true nucleus.
Cocci
Spherical bacteria.
Bacilli
Rod-shaped bacteria.
Spirilla
Spiral or twisted bacteria.
Vibrio
Comma-shaped bacteria.
Diplococci
Bacteria occurring in pairs.
Streptococci
Bacteria occurring in long chains.
Staphylococci
Bacteria occurring in clusters or bunches.
Micrometre
A unit of length equal to one thousandth of a millimetre (1micrometre=10001mm).
Average Bacterial Size
The average dimensions of a bacterial cell, measuring 2micrometres long and 0.5micrometre thick.
Intestinal Bacteria
Beneficial bacteria occurring inside the intestines that synthesise certain vitamins, such as vitamin B.
Skin Bacteria
Bacteria normally living on human skin that serve a beneficial role by preventing the growth of harmful bacteria.
